ArtboardResizeWithObjects终极指南:一键同步调整画板与对象尺寸的完整教程
2026/5/31 19:08:15 网站建设 项目流程

ArtboardResizeWithObjects终极指南:一键同步调整画板与对象尺寸的完整教程

【免费下载链接】illustrator-scriptsAdobe Illustrator scripts项目地址: https://gitcode.com/gh_mirrors/il/illustrator-scripts

在Adobe Illustrator设计工作中,artboardsResizeWithObjects.jsx脚本是设计师们提升工作效率的利器,它能智能同步调整画板与对象尺寸,彻底告别手动调整的繁琐。这款专为Illustrator CS5+设计的免费脚本,通过自动化处理大幅简化了画板尺寸调整流程,让设计师能够专注于创意而非技术细节。

🎯 项目核心价值:为什么你需要这个脚本?

artboardsResizeWithObjects.jsx解决了Illustrator设计中最常见的痛点之一:当需要调整画板大小时,所有对象的位置和比例都需要手动重新调整。传统方法不仅耗时,还容易导致设计元素错位。这款脚本的核心价值在于:

  • 智能同步缩放:保持对象与画板的相对位置和比例关系
  • 多模式调整:支持比例缩放、指定宽度或高度三种灵活方式
  • 批量处理能力:可同时调整多个画板,大幅提升工作效率
  • 单位智能转换:自动识别文档单位,支持px、mm、cm、in等多种单位系统

📋 安装配置:快速上手指南

获取脚本文件

首先需要从开源仓库获取脚本文件:

git clone https://gitcode.com/gh_mirrors/il/illustrator-scripts

安装到Illustrator

将下载的artboardsResizeWithObjects.jsx文件放置到Illustrator脚本目录:

  • Windows系统C:\Program Files\Adobe\Adobe Illustrator [版本]\Presets\[语言]\Scripts\
  • macOS系统Applications/Adobe Illustrator [版本]/Presets/[语言]/Scripts/

启用脚本

重启Illustrator后,在菜单栏选择文件 → 脚本 → artboardsResizeWithObjects即可开始使用。

🚀 实战操作:三种调整模式详解

模式一:按比例缩放画板

这是最常用的调整方式,适用于整体放大或缩小设计稿:

  1. 在脚本对话框中选择"新缩放比例"选项
  2. 输入缩放百分比(如输入"150%"表示放大1.5倍)
  3. 选择需要调整的画板范围
  4. 点击"OK"完成智能缩放

模式二:精确设置画板宽度

当需要将画板调整为特定宽度时:

  1. 选择"新画板宽度"单选按钮
  2. 输入目标宽度值(支持带单位,如"200mm"、"800px")
  3. 脚本会自动计算高度比例,保持对象同步调整
  4. 确认后完成精确宽度设置

模式三:自定义画板高度调整

针对需要特定高度的设计场景:

  1. 选择"新画板高度"选项
  2. 输入目标高度数值和单位
  3. 系统智能调整宽度比例
  4. 一键完成高度定制

🔧 高级功能:批量处理与自定义选项

批量处理多个画板

脚本支持三种画板选择范围:

  • 仅当前画板:只调整当前激活的画板
  • 所有画板:批量调整文档中的所有画板
  • 自定义画板:指定特定画板编号(如"1,3-5"表示第1、3、4、5个画板)

包含隐藏和锁定项目

默认情况下,脚本不会处理被锁定或隐藏的项目。如需包含这些项目,只需勾选"包含隐藏和锁定项目"选项,脚本会自动临时解锁并显示这些项目进行调整。

智能单位转换

脚本内置单位转换系统,支持:

  • 像素(px)与毫米(mm)互转
  • 厘米(cm)与英寸(in)转换
  • 自动适配文档当前单位设置

💡 使用场景与技巧

场景一:响应式设计适配

为不同设备创建适配版本时,可以快速调整画板尺寸,同时保持设计元素的比例和相对位置。

场景二:打印尺寸调整

从屏幕设计转向打印输出时,需要精确的毫米或厘米单位,脚本的单位转换功能大大简化了这一过程。

场景三:多画板统一调整

当文档包含多个画板且需要统一尺寸时,批量处理功能可以一次性完成所有调整。

实用技巧

  • 撤销操作:调整后可使用Ctrl+Z(Windows)或Cmd+Z(macOS)快速撤销
  • 预览效果:建议先在小范围测试,确认效果后再应用到重要文档
  • 坐标系统:脚本使用画板坐标系统,确保位置计算的精确性

❓ 常见问题解答

Q: 脚本运行时提示"没有活动文档"怎么办?

A: 请确保已打开至少一个Illustrator文档,脚本需要在有活动文档的情况下才能正常运行。

Q: 调整后对象位置发生偏移如何处理?

A: 这通常是因为选择了错误的坐标系统。脚本默认使用画板坐标系统,建议不要修改此设置以确保计算准确性。

Q: 能否同时调整多个画板到不同尺寸?

A: 当前版本暂不支持为不同画板设置不同尺寸,批量调整时所有选中画板会应用相同的调整参数。

Q: 支持哪些Illustrator版本?

A: 脚本兼容Adobe Illustrator CS5及更高版本,包括最新的CC系列。

Q: 如何处理复杂的嵌套对象?

A: 脚本会处理所有可见和未锁定的页面项目,包括群组、复合路径等复杂结构。

🔗 相关脚本推荐

artboardsResizeWithObjects.jsx是Illustrator脚本集合中的重要一员,同系列还有其他实用工具:

  • artboardsRotateWithObjects.jsx:同步旋转画板与对象,支持90度顺时针/逆时针旋转
  • createArtboardsFromTheSelection.jsx:根据选择对象快速创建新画板
  • artboardItemsMoveToNewLayer.jsx:将画板项目批量移动到新图层,便于组织管理
  • transferSwatches.jsx:在不同文档间复制色板,保持颜色一致性

📊 性能优化建议

内存管理

处理大型文档时,建议:

  1. 先保存当前工作
  2. 关闭不必要的面板和文档
  3. 分批处理大量画板

工作流程整合

将脚本整合到日常设计流程中:

  1. 创建设计稿时使用标准画板尺寸
  2. 需要调整时运行脚本快速适配
  3. 利用批量处理功能统一多画板设计

快捷键配置

虽然脚本本身没有快捷键,但可以通过Illustrator的动作面板创建自定义动作,将脚本执行绑定到快捷键上。

🎨 设计师的真实反馈

实际使用中,设计师们发现这款脚本特别适合以下场景:

  • UI/UX设计:快速适配不同屏幕尺寸的设计稿
  • 印刷设计:精确调整打印尺寸和出血区域
  • 品牌设计:统一多个画板的品牌规范尺寸
  • 教育材料:创建不同尺寸的教学模板

🔄 持续更新与支持

artboardsResizeWithObjects.jsx作为开源项目持续维护,用户可以通过项目仓库提交问题或功能请求。脚本基于MIT许可证,允许自由使用、修改和分发。

📝 总结:提升设计效率的关键工具

通过artboardsResizeWithObjects.jsx脚本,设计师可以:

  • 节省大量手动调整时间
  • 确保设计元素的精确比例和位置
  • 实现批量处理的一致性
  • 轻松在不同单位系统间转换

无论你是UI设计师、平面设计师还是插画师,这款脚本都能显著提升你在Adobe Illustrator中的工作效率。安装简单、操作直观、功能强大,是每个Illustrator用户都值得拥有的效率工具。

开始使用artboardsResizeWithObjects.jsx,体验智能画板调整带来的流畅设计工作流吧!🚀

【免费下载链接】illustrator-scriptsAdobe Illustrator scripts项目地址: https://gitcode.com/gh_mirrors/il/illustrator-scripts

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询